Irei usar OPEN VPN.
è que não sei muito programação no shell. Conheço apenas alguns comandos Sei que terei que filtrar o ifconfig eth0 | grep ???? e depois comparar com a linha 3 apartir da nº coluna. mas isso ñ sei fazer por shell. Gostaria de uma ajuda, como filtrar, como abrir o arquivo da vpn e comprar e como alterar o ip. Talvez seria até melhor eu criar uma váriavel no arquivo da vpn, pois só mudo essa variavel. ############## Essa seria minha configuração no server: remote 200.20.10.1 dev tun ifconfig 172.16.1.1 172.16.1.2 up /etc/openvpn/up.sh down /etc/openvpn/down.sh secret /etc/openvpn/key # ativa compressão LZO - se desejável. Precisa instalar o pacote LZO comp-lzo # Envia um ping a cada 15 segundos ping 15 port 5002 # Usuários e grupo que devem rodar o processo openvpn user nobody group nobody Em 19/04/07, andrebarretosantos <[EMAIL PROTECTED]> escreveu: > > Que VPN você vai usar ? > Manda a sintaxe do arquivo da VPN. > > --- Em shell-script@yahoogrupos.com.br <shell-script%40yahoogrupos.com.br>, > "Eric Anderson" <[EMAIL PROTECTED]> > escreveu > > > > > Qual sua dúvida específica? > > > > A lógica vc tem > > > > 1.. "pegar" o ip da sua interface eth0 > > 2.. comparar com o "arquivo da VPN" ( que eu não sei qual é =P) > > 3.. if (mudou) atualiza else num faz nada > > 4.. te mandar um email com o número de cada ip (quais ip´s). > > O que vc não sabe fazer? > > > > sds > > > > Eric > > > > > > ----- Original Message ----- > > From: Rafael Tomelin > > To: shell-script@yahoogrupos.com.br <shell-script%40yahoogrupos.com.br> > > Sent: Thursday, April 19, 2007 9:25 AM > > Subject: [shell-script] Ajuda com criação de script - verificar IP > > > > > > Olá Pessoal, > > > > Estou instalando uma VPN, porém meu IP é dinâmico. Então vou fazer um > > script e colocar no cron para rodar a cada 30min. > > > > O que estou precisando na minha ajuda é o seguinte: > > > > Quero verificar o meu IP atual (ifconfig eth0) e comparar com o > arquivo da > > VPN para ver se o IP é o mesmo ou se ele mudo. Caso tenha mudado ele > > atualiza o arquivo da VPN. > > Indiferente, se ele mudar ou não i IP, quero que me mande um email > > informando qual o numero de cada IP. > > > > Como que posso fazer isso? > > > > [As partes desta mensagem que não continham texto foram removidas] > > > > > > > > > > > > [As partes desta mensagem que não continham texto foram removidas] > > > > > [As partes desta mensagem que não continham texto foram removidas]